William Purdue

Birth1731 - Newbury
DeathNot Available - Not Available
MotherHannah Hurd
FatherWilliam Augustus Purdue

Born in Newbury on 1731 to William Augustus Purdue and Hannah Hurd. William Purdue married Hannah Flatman and had 11 children.
